Skip to content

Commit 1dd1b55

Browse files
committed
fix: wrong import path (close: #937)
1 parent b084114 commit 1dd1b55

File tree

7 files changed

+6
-7
lines changed

7 files changed

+6
-7
lines changed

packages/@vuepress/core/lib/prepare/Page.js

+1-2
Original file line numberDiff line numberDiff line change
@@ -4,9 +4,8 @@
44
* Module dependencies.
55
*/
66

7-
const slugify = require('../../../markdown/lib/slugify')
87
const { inferDate, DATE_RE } = require('../util/index')
9-
const { extractHeaders, fs, path, fileToPath, parseFrontmatter, getPermalink, inferTitle } = require('@vuepress/shared-utils')
8+
const { extractHeaders, fs, path, fileToPath, parseFrontmatter, getPermalink, inferTitle, slugify } = require('@vuepress/shared-utils')
109

1110
/**
1211
* Expose Page class.

packages/@vuepress/markdown/__tests__/slugify.spec.js

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
import { Md } from './util'
22
import anchor from 'markdown-it-anchor'
3-
import slugify from '../lib/slugify.js'
3+
import slugify from '../../shared-utils/lib/slugify.js'
44

55
const mdS = Md().use(anchor, {
66
slugify,

packages/@vuepress/markdown/lib/index.js

+1-2
Original file line numberDiff line numberDiff line change
@@ -17,8 +17,7 @@ const snippetPlugin = require('./snippet')
1717
const emojiPlugin = require('markdown-it-emoji')
1818
const anchorPlugin = require('markdown-it-anchor')
1919
const tocPlugin = require('markdown-it-table-of-contents')
20-
const _slugify = require('./slugify')
21-
const { parseHeaders } = require('@vuepress/shared-utils')
20+
const { parseHeaders, slugify: _slugify } = require('@vuepress/shared-utils')
2221

2322
/**
2423
* Create markdown by config.

packages/@vuepress/markdown/package.json

-1
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,6 @@
1919
],
2020
"dependencies": {
2121
"@vuepress/shared-utils": "^1.0.0-alpha.11",
22-
"diacritics": "^1.3.0",
2322
"markdown-it": "^8.4.1",
2423
"markdown-it-anchor": "^5.0.2",
2524
"markdown-it-chain": "^1.2.1",

packages/@vuepress/shared-utils/index.js

+1
Original file line numberDiff line numberDiff line change
@@ -31,3 +31,4 @@ exports.globby = require('globby')
3131
exports.hash = require('hash-sum')
3232

3333
exports.fallback = require('./lib/fallback')
34+
exports.slugify = require('./lib/slugify')

packages/@vuepress/shared-utils/package.json

+2-1
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,8 @@
2222
"fs-extra": "^5.0.0",
2323
"globby": "^8.0.1",
2424
"hash-sum": "^1.0.2",
25-
"upath": "^1.1.0"
25+
"upath": "^1.1.0",
26+
"diacritics": "^1.3.0"
2627
},
2728
"author": "ULIVZ <chl814@foxmail.com>",
2829
"license": "MIT",

0 commit comments

Comments
 (0)